AFnord: If you are new to the game, I would recommend against playing a stunty team (Goblins, Ogres & Halflings). Lizardmen is an interesting exception, because while their skinks are super squishy, they can, unlike the other teams with stunties, actually field a good amount of strong players, and their strong players don't suffer from major drawbacks, like bonehead, really stupid or rooted to the spot.

Piranjade: For a really strange experience with a partly stunty team I recommend Underworld.

Also I believe that playing stunty for a season or two can be a good experience as you have to learn completely different tactics and your frustration tolerance will most likely increase. By a lot.
Playing a "normal" team afterwards can feel so relaxing then. :-)
I would still recommend starting with a "normal" team, one where the key players already have the most important skills (this is usually block on the more bashy players & something like sure hands so that you can pick up the ball, to the later is not super important). Stunties are fun to play, once you know how the game works, but seeing your entire team getting wiped out is a disheartening experience for a new player.

Ive always thought that halflings should have special rule allowing them more than 16 players:

The limit of 16 players per team was only introduced in 2482. Previously, a team could swap players as often as it wished. The rule was finally introduced after the deaths of 743 Halflings from the Greenfield Grasshuggers at the hands of the Asgard Ravens Norse berserker team

..and other interesting bits of info, probably taken from various editions of BB rulebook.
